radiofree.asia
September 18, 2023
Tuareg rebels claim control of army bases in northern Mali
This post was originally published on
Al Jazeera English
.
←
Florida beachgoers risk life and limb to drag beached shark into sea
Lead Republican in Biden Impeachment Push CRUSHED By CNN Anchor
→